Group A1 of the 2026/27 UEFA Nations League features four high-caliber sides—France, Italy, Belgium, and Türkiye—in a double round-robin that opens on 25 September. With no matches yet played, the even pricing reflects traders' assessment of comparable squad depth, recent international pedigree, and balanced home/away fixtures. France brings attacking options and experience from major tournaments, while Italy emphasizes defensive structure and tactical discipline. Belgium relies on veteran leadership and transitional play, and Türkiye has shown improved organization and momentum in recent cycles. Schedule congestion, potential injuries, and early results will likely shift the implied probabilities as the league phase progresses through November.
